you can still have a relaxed attitude towards your drive when the mood takes you, after driving with the sb for a while you will just learn to adjust your input on the throttle pedal to suit what you require

as far as resetting the ecu adaptions, i'm finding i'm still having to do this on average about once a week as it does still seem to be learning

i also seem to be getting less miles from a gallon of fuel, not sure if this is down to me or the booster but my average has gone down by about 2-3 mpg yet i dont feel as though my driving style has changed any

yeah, you definitely say 'j-christ' and 'holy ****' when it's fresh on the car. On the other hand, my GF says 'you're a f-ing idiot' when she's in the car with me.
Seriously though - I'm finding adaptation way too fast with mine. It is to the point where I have to use it for 2-3 weeks, remove it for a week (or about 100 miles) and then reinstall to see the effects again. Bit of a pain in the ***, but it sure is nice when I reinstall!
